Cheesy Garlic Cajun Chicken Bowtie Pasta in Alfredo Sauce – Must-Try Magic!

  • Total Time: 30 mins
  • Yield: 4 servings

Description

A creamy and flavorful pasta dish with tender chicken, garlic, Cajun spices, and bowtie pasta in a rich Alfredo sauce.


Ingredients

  • 12 oz bowtie pasta
  • 1 lb bo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cubed
  • 2 tbsp Cajun seasoning
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 2 tbsp butter
  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 1/4 tsp black pepper
  • 1/4 cup chopped parsley (optional)


Instructions

  1. Cook bowtie pasta according to package instructions. Drain and set aside.
  2. Season chicken with Cajun seasoning, salt, and pepper.
  3.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add chicken and cook until browned and cooked through, about 6-8 minutes. Remove and set aside.
  4. In the same skillet, melt butter and sauté garlic until fragrant, about 1 minute.
  5. Pour in heavy cream and bring to a simmer. Stir in Parmesan cheese until the sauce thickens.
  6. Add cooked pasta and chicken to the skillet, tossing to coat in the sauce.
  7. Garnish with parsley if desired and serve hot.

Notes

  • Adjust Cajun seasoning to taste for more or less spice.
  • Use freshly grated Parmesan for best flavor.
  • Add a splash of pasta water if the sauce is too thick.
  • Prep Time: 10 mins
  • Cook Time: 20 mins
